NYC Mayor Wants $1 Billion For Migrant Crisis

  • New York City Mayor Eric Adams reportedly has requested about $1 billion in federal funding to help handle a sudden influx of migrants.
  • FEMA’s Emergency Food and Shelter Program’s National Board told the Post that the city has sent a fundraising request.
  • The Post reports that according to New York City Hall, the city currently has about 21,000 migrants in taxpayer-funded housing out of about 30,000 migrants currently living in the city.
